Myrtenyl acetate Chemical Properties

Molecule structure of Myrtenyl acetate (CAS NO.1079-01-2) :

IUPAC Name: (7,7-dimethyl-4-bicyclo[3.1.1]hept-3-enyl)methyl acetate 
Molecular Weight: 194.27012 g/mol
Molecular Formula: C12H18O2 
Density: 1.009 g/cm3 
Boiling Point: 243.2 °C at 760 mmHg 
Flash Point: 97.8 °C
Index of Refraction: 1.483
Molar Refractivity: 54.98 cm3
Molar Volume: 192.4 cm3
Polarizability: 21.79*10-24 cm3
Surface Tension: 30.7 dyne/cm 
Enthalpy of Vaporization: 48.03 kJ/mol
Vapour Pressure: 0.0325 mmHg at 25 °C
XLogP3-AA: 2.2
H-Bond Acceptor: 2
Rotatable Bond Count: 3
Exact Mass: 194.13068
MonoIsotopic Mass: 194.13068
Topological Polar Surface Area: 26.3
Heavy Atom Count: 14 
Complexity: 289
Canonical SMILES: CC(=O)OCC1=CCC2CC1C2(C)C
InChI: InChI=1S/C12H18O2/c1-8(13)14-7-9-4-5-10-6-11(9)12(10,2)3/h4,10-11H,5-7H2,1-3H3
InChIKey: BKATZVAUANSCKN-UHFFFAOYSA-N
EINECS of Myrtenyl acetate (CAS NO.1079-01-2) : 252-909-9

Myrtenyl acetate Toxicity Data With Reference

1.    

orl-rat LD50:2600 mg/kg

    FCTOD7    Food and Chemical Toxicology. 26 (1988),389.
2.    

skn-rbt LDLo:5 g/kg

    FCTOD7    Food and Chemical Toxicology. 26 (1988),389.

Myrtenyl acetate Consensus Reports

Reported in EPA TSCA Inventory.

Myrtenyl acetate Safety Profile

Moderately toxic by ingestion. Slightly toxic by skin contact. When heated to decomposition it emits acrid smoke and irritating vapors.
WGK Germany: 2
RTECS: DT6500000
